Abstract

The embodiment of the application discloses a method and a device for updating a webpage theme, which are characterized in that color values corresponding to user interaction behaviors are recorded, target color values are determined from the color values corresponding to the user interaction behaviors, and the target color values can represent the preference of a user for colors; then, a current theme background picture of the target website is obtained, and a picture which is similar to the current theme background picture and has the same color system as the target color value is determined to be used as a target picture; when the user accesses the target website again, the theme color of the target website can be set to the color corresponding to the target color value, and the theme background picture of the target website is set to be the target picture, so that the automatic update of the webpage theme is completed. In the process, according to the user behavior and the current website theme background picture, the target color and the target picture are automatically acquired, the webpage theme update is automatically completed, the webpage theme update of each website can be realized aiming at different target websites, and the efficiency of the webpage theme update is improved.

Referring to fig. 2, the flowchart of a method for implementing web page theme update according to an embodiment of the present application is shown in fig. 2, where the method may include:
s201: and recording the color value corresponding to the user interaction behavior.
In this embodiment, when a user browses different websites through a browser, color values corresponding to interaction behaviors may be recorded. The user interaction behavior is generated when the user accesses each website, for example, a mouse clicks an area, an area pointed by the mouse, and the like, and according to each interaction behavior, a color value corresponding to the interaction behavior, for example, a color value of the area clicked by the mouse, and a color value of the area pointed by the mouse currently, is recorded.
The color value corresponding to the interaction behavior is used for indicating the color corresponding to the interaction behavior, and in specific implementation, the color value may be expressed in various forms, such as RGB, CMYK, HSB. Where RGB is the identification of a color by superposition of three color channels Red (Red), green (Green), blue (Blue). CMYK is a color identified by a mix of three color channels, cyan (Cyan), magenta (Magenta), yellow (Yellow), black (Black). HSB is a color identified by three dimensions of Hue (Hue), saturation (Saturation), and Brightness (Brightness).
For easy understanding, RGB is taken as an example to illustrate, and when the color corresponding to the user interaction behavior is pink, a color value (255, 181, 197) corresponding to the pink is obtained; when the color corresponding to the user interaction behavior is light purple, acquiring a color value (230, 230, 250) corresponding to the light purple; and when the color corresponding to the user interaction behavior is white, acquiring a color value (255, 255, 255) corresponding to the white.
S202: and determining the target color value from the color values corresponding to the user interaction behaviors.
In this embodiment, when the color value corresponding to the user interaction behavior is acquired, the target color value is determined from the acquired color values. In practical applications, a user accessing a website may generate a plurality of interactions, each of which may correspond to a different color value, and thus, a target color value may be determined from the plurality of color values.
It is understood that the color values corresponding to the plurality of user interaction behaviors may be the same or different. When a user accesses a website, the number of occurrences of the corresponding color value of the interaction behavior generated during the user's access to the website may be recorded. When the obtained color value corresponding to a certain user interaction behavior is recorded, 1 can be added on the basis of the original recording, and when the obtained color value corresponding to the certain user interaction behavior is not recorded, the color value is recorded. When the target color value is determined from the color values corresponding to the user interaction behaviors, the target color value can be determined according to the times corresponding to each color value.
The step S202 may be to acquire the color value corresponding to the user interaction behavior with the largest number of recordings in the preset time period, and determine the color value corresponding to the user interaction behavior with the largest number of recordings in the preset time period as the target color value. The preset time period may be a preset time period of a certain length, for example, the preset time period may be 3 days. The preset time period may be specifically set according to actual situations, which is not limited in this embodiment.
In specific implementation, the number of times corresponding to the color value recorded in the preset time period is obtained, and the color value with the largest recording number is determined to be the target color value. For example, the color value corresponding to the user interaction behavior is recorded as (255, 255, 255) -white, (255, 181, 197) -pink, (230, 230, 250) -light purple in a preset time period, wherein the occurrence number of (255, 255, 255) is 5, (230, 230, 250) is 2, and the occurrence number of (255, 181, 197) is 1, and then the color value (255, 255, 255) corresponding to the white is determined as the target color value.
S203: and obtaining the current theme background picture of the target website.
In this embodiment, a current theme background picture of a target website accessed by a user is obtained, so that S204 is executed to determine a target picture according to the current theme background picture. The target website can be any one of the websites generating the user interaction behavior, and the target website can be understood as a website needing to update the theme of the webpage. The target website can be set by the user, or any website which can update the theme of the webpage can be selected from the websites.
It will be appreciated that a website may include one or more theme background pictures, and that when the current theme background picture of the target website is obtained, if the target website includes multiple theme background pictures, each current theme background picture may be obtained. In addition, when the current background picture of the target website is acquired, not only the current theme background picture, but also the position for displaying the theme background picture and the display size of the theme background picture can be acquired. When the website includes a plurality of theme background pictures, in order to ensure that a user can view each theme background picture, the display position of each theme background picture on the website is different, and the size of each theme background picture may also be different, so as to display the theme background picture conforming to the display size at the corresponding position. Therefore, the position and display size of each subject background picture can also be acquired.
In particular implementations, a current theme background picture of a web site that can be targeted and a display position and a display size of the theme background picture may be acquired by analyzing a cascading style sheet (Cascading Style Sheets, CSS) of a web page. The CSS can accurately control typesetting of element positions in the webpage and edit webpage objects and model styles.
It should be noted that, in actual implementation, S203 may be executed to obtain the current theme background picture of the target website, and then S202 may be executed to determine the target color value, where the execution sequence of S202 and S203 is not limited in this embodiment.
S204: and determining a target picture matched with the target color value and the current theme background picture.
In this embodiment, when the current theme background picture of the target website is obtained through S203, a picture matching with the current theme background picture may be searched from the network according to the current theme background picture, and then the target picture is determined from the matched pictures according to the target color value. That is, the theme of the target picture not only accords with the theme of the website, but also has the same color as the color corresponding to the target color value, so that the theme accords with the preference of the user.
In one possible implementation manner, the present embodiment provides an implementation manner of searching for a matched picture according to a current theme background picture, specifically, performing semantic analysis on the current theme background picture, and then retrieving a picture having the same semantic meaning as the current theme background picture.
Firstly, carrying out semantic analysis on a current theme background picture, obtaining the specific semantic of the current theme background picture, and then searching pictures with the same semantic in a network. In a specific implementation, when the current theme background picture includes characters, the characters in the current theme background picture can be identified through optical character recognition (OpticalCharacterRecognition, OCR) and the semantics represented by the characters are obtained, and then, the pictures with the same semantics are searched through a web crawler mode. When the current theme background picture includes a person, an event, etc., the picture semantics can also be analyzed by using the image recognition technology, and then the picture having the same semantics is retrieved by means of a web crawler.
S204 may be to take a picture having the same semantic meaning and the picture color system being the color corresponding to the target color value as the target picture. That is, when a plurality of pictures having the same semantics are retrieved, it is determined from the plurality of pictures that the picture color is the color corresponding to the target color value is the target picture.
In addition, when a plurality of theme background pictures are included in the web page, a corresponding target picture may be determined for each theme background picture.
S205: when the user accesses the target website again, setting the theme color of the target website as the color corresponding to the target color value, and setting the theme background picture of the target website as the target picture.
In this embodiment, the setting of the webpage theme is already completed according to the preference of the user through S201-S204, and when the user accesses the target website again, the theme color of the target website is updated to the color corresponding to the target color value, and the theme background picture of the target website is updated to the target picture, so as to realize automatic update of the webpage theme.
It should be noted that, when the theme background picture of the target website is set as the target picture, whether the target picture can be normally displayed may be further determined according to the display size obtained in S203, and if the size of the target picture is in accordance with the display size, the theme background picture of the target website is set as the target picture; if the size of the target picture does not conform to the display size, the target picture may be scaled and/or cut to the display size to generate a processed target picture, and then S205 is executed by using the processed target picture, where the processed target picture is set at the display position of the theme background picture of the target website.

In one possible implementation manner of the embodiment of the present application, in order to ensure that when determining the target picture, there is a picture matching with the color corresponding to the target color value, the embodiment further provides an implementation manner of determining a series of approximate color values according to the target color value and then determining the target picture according to the approximate color value. For ease of understanding, the implementation will be described below with reference to the accompanying drawings.
Referring to fig. 3, a flowchart of another method for implementing web page theme update according to an embodiment of the present application is shown in fig. 3, where the method may include:
s301: and recording the color value corresponding to the user interaction behavior.
S302: and determining the target color value from the color values corresponding to the user interaction behaviors.
S303: and obtaining the current theme background picture of the target website.
It should be noted that, in this embodiment, S301 to S303 and S201 to S203 have the same implementation, and specific reference may be made to S201 to S203, which is not described herein.
S304: and acquiring the numerical value of each color channel in the target color value.
In this embodiment, the values of the respective color channels corresponding to the target color values need to be obtained, and the color values have multiple rendering forms, for example, RGB, CMYK, etc., where RGB has three color channels and CMYK has four color channels.
For ease of understanding, this embodiment will be described with reference to (Red, green, blue, alpha, RGBA). Among them, alpha channel is generally used as an opacity parameter. If the alpha channel value for a pixel is 0%, it indicates a completely transparent pixel, while a value of 100% indicates a completely opaque pixel. Values between 0% and 100% allow the pixel to be displayed across the background. In particular implementations, when the target color values are expressed in other ways, they may be converted to RGBA first and then the value for each channel obtained.
When the RGBA corresponding to the target color value is (230, 230, 250, 50%), the red channel value is 230, the green channel value is 230, the blue channel value is 250, and the alpha channel value is 50%.
S305: and obtaining the numerical value of each color channel within a preset range, and obtaining a group of approximate numerical values of each color channel.
In this embodiment, for any color channel, a value of the color access value within a preset range is obtained, so as to obtain a set of approximate values of the color access.
The preset range corresponding to the color channel may be [ x-a, x+b ], where x represents a value of the color channel, x-a and x+b represent a minimum value and a maximum value of the preset range of the value of the color channel, a and b may be the same or different, both are natural numbers greater than zero, and specific values of a and b may be set according to practical application situations. In specific implementation, a and b may be the same or different for each color channel.
For ease of understanding, the values of each color channel correspond to a predetermined range of [ x-5, x+5], then the approximate values of the red channel are 225-235, the approximate values of the green channel are 225-235, the approximate values of the blue channel are 245-255, and the approximate values of the alpha channel are 45% -55%. It will be appreciated that in practical applications, since the values of the color channels are all integers, the above-mentioned approximate values are also integers within a predetermined range.
S306: any one of a set of approximation values for each color channel is combined to generate an approximation color value for a plurality of target color values.
In this embodiment, one value is extracted from a set of approximate values of each color channel and combined, so that approximate color values of a plurality of target color values can be generated. For example, a plurality of approximation color values corresponding to a target color value may be generated by combining the different values of the different color channels, such as from a set of approximation values for the red channel 228, a set of approximation values for the green channel 232, a set of approximation values for the blue channel 248, a set of approximation values for the alpha channel 55%, combining the four values to generate an approximation color value (228,232,248,55%), and so on.
S307: and carrying out semantic analysis on the current theme background picture.
S308: and searching a picture which has the same semantic meaning as the current theme background picture and has a color corresponding to the approximate color value as a target picture.
In this embodiment, when a picture having the same semantic meaning as the current theme background picture is retrieved, a picture whose color is a color corresponding to an approximation value is taken as the target picture.
In a specific implementation, a plurality of approximation color values may be generated through S306, and when there are a plurality of pictures whose color systems are colors corresponding to the approximation color values, a picture in which the colors corresponding to the target color values are the closest match is determined as the target picture.
S309: when the user accesses the target website again, setting the theme color of the target website as the color corresponding to the target color value, and setting the theme background picture of the target website as the target picture.
In this embodiment, the design of the website is completed through S301-S308, when the user accesses the target website again, the theme color of the target website is updated to the color corresponding to the target color value, and the theme background picture of the target website is updated to the target picture, so as to update the theme of the webpage.
In the specific implementation, when the theme background picture of the target website is updated to be the target picture, the display position and the display size of the theme background picture of the target website can be obtained first, then the target picture is scaled and/or cut to the display size to generate a processed target picture, and finally the processed target picture is arranged at the display position of the theme background picture of the target website, so that the theme background picture of the target website is updated according to the preset display position and display size.
Through the embodiment, the plurality of approximate color values of the target color value can be determined according to the numerical value of each color channel in the target color value, and then the target picture is determined according to the approximate color values, so that the problem that the target picture cannot be determined due to mismatching of the color system of the retrieved picture and the color corresponding to the target color value is avoided, the existence probability of the target picture is improved, and further the update of the webpage theme is realized.
